A good security system has many more features than sounding the alarm during a break-in. Many systems sound an alert whenever people enter the house. This is a valuable safety feature for parents of small children since they know if their child has exited the home.

When deciding on an alarm system, it’s a good idea to get one that provides protection for both doors and windows. All of your windows can be entry spots for a thief too. You want to be sure that the alarm is connected to all windows and doors. This is a way to make sure your family safer.

If you are moving into a new home, you should first change your locks. The person who used to live there may still have made some copies of the key. You can install locks so that you are assured of having the only keys.

Screen the references of anyone who would have access to your house. For a relatively small fee, you can also run a background check for their criminal history. You might not know that the maid or contractor entering your home is a crook, and this could be a very bad mistake.

Think about getting a home security system that is wireless. Wired systems may be cheaper, however it usually means you’ll have to rewire your home, and your system may get finicky in the event of a power outage. Wireless systems tend to be easier for installation and maintenance, and they will not go out if your power does.

Do not buy spring latches. These locks can actually be opened up with a credit card. Intruders can pick these locks by wedging a credit card in between the latch and door for the lock to pop open. Add a deadbolt to existing spring latch locks.

Ask the company if they offer options to lease or buy your security equipment. Buying the equipment might cost more up front, but this means there are no monthly charges. Leasing is cheaper, but you will have to pay monthly fees. Look into both of these to see what works for you.

If you want maximum security, make sure that your exterior doors are either solid wood or metal. These doors hold really good. A burglar could not kick a solid wood or a metal door. You are probably able to replace your exterior doors for a small price, so do that soon.

Few people realize that a smoke detector needs to be cleaned periodically. This is also true of a carbon monoxide detector. They tend to get dust on them which can prevent the sensors from going off when they should. That is why detectors can’t help protect your house from carbon monoxide and smoke.
